| 
							
							
								 ocornut | 33d18c580b | Misc: During shutdown, check that io.BackendPlatformUserData and io.BackendRendererUserData are NULL. (#7175) | 2024-01-03 14:56:21 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 0ea99132c8 | Backends: Vulkan: Stop creating command pools with VK_COMMAND_POOL_CREATE_RESET_COMMAND_BUFFER_BIT as we don't reset them. | 2024-01-03 14:11:40 +01:00 |  | 
			
				
					| 
							
							
								 Tristan Gouge | 4778560e66 | Backends: Vulkan: Added MinAllocationSize field in ImGui_ImplVulkan_InitInfo to workaround zealous validation layer. (#7189, #4238) | 2024-01-03 12:17:08 +01:00 |  | 
			
				
					| 
							
							
								 Axel Paris | e8dd47effa | Backends: WebGPU: Fixing an issue when opening a popup in the wgpu backend (#7191) Amend 2b0bd40b9 | 2024-01-03 12:05:37 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 718fa0eec6 | Happy new year! | 2024-01-02 22:03:36 +01:00 |  | 
			
				
					| 
							
							
								 kida22 | 240ab5890b | Backends: GLFW, Input: Use Unicode version of WndProc for get correct input for text in utf-8 code page. (#7174) Similar to #6785, #6782, #5725, #5961 for for GLFW backend. | 2023-12-29 18:21:21 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 4a2426449a | Drags, Sliders, Inputs: removed all attempts to filter non-numerical characters during text editing. (#6810, #7096) | 2023-12-22 19:51:49 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| f039e69b9c | Settings: Fixed an issue marking settings as dirty when merely clicking on a border or resize grip without moving it. | 2023-12-21 14:14:39 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 8340a30d27 | Debug: move debug assertion in post-clip code to reduce overhead. (#4796 and more). Amend c80179921 | 2023-12-20 16:23:27 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 1e1013085b | Debug Tools: Debug Log: Hide its own clipper log to reduce noise in the output. | 2023-12-20 16:22:35 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 036a6c875e | ColorEdit4: Further tweaks for very small sizes. (#7120, #7121) | 2023-12-20 11:06:22 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 0bd6489721 | DragScalarN, SliderScalarN, InputScalarN, PushMultiItemsWidths: fixed multi-components width in tight space (#7120, #7121) + extra tweak color ColorEdit4() label. Amend 86512ea,3464662 | 2023-12-19 20:50:17 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 0000739c08 | Internals: Fixed function name typo. | 2023-12-19 20:32:09 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 33d426842d | Backends: Vulkan: ImGui_ImplVulkan_CreateFontsTexture() calls vkQueueWaitIdle() instead of vkDeviceWaitIdle(). (#7148, #6943, #6715, #6327, #3743, #4618) | 2023-12-19 18:25:09 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 3cb805489b | Backends: GLFW, Emscripten: fixes for canvas resizing, amends. (#6751) Amend 22a7d24 | 2023-12-19 16:09:44 +01:00 |  | 
			
				
					| 
							
							
								 Pello Rao | 22a7d241ff | Backends: GLFW, Emscripten: fixes for canvas resizing. (#6751) | 2023-12-19 15:56:31 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| b4c5a83cfe | Commented out obsolete ImGuiKey_KeyPadEnter redirection to ImGuiKey_KeypadEnter. (#2625, #7143) | 2023-12-19 13:55:09 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 70f2aaff43 | Nav: tabbing happen within FocusScope. ImGuiWindowFlags_NavFlattened make window inherit focus scope from parent. | 2023-12-19 13:48:04 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 55073aa7a3 | Examples; SDL: added missing return values checks from SDL_CreateWindow() calls. (#7147) | 2023-12-19 11:22:43 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 8764a1b7c4 | Backends: Vulkan: free FontCommandBuffer explicitely (not actually required in normal code path, unless ImGui_ImplVulkan_DestroyDeviceObjects is declared directly). (#7104) | 2023-12-19 10:51:15 +01:00 |  | 
			
				
					| 
							
							
								 Kevin Coghlan | 089ed30323 | Replace usages of ImGuiKey_KeyPadEnter with ImGuiKey_KeypadEnter. (#7143) | 2023-12-19 00:30:49 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| e265610a0c | Fixes for MSVC code analyzer. | 2023-12-18 18:36:01 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| f59b54c6f4 | Nav: Activation can also be performed with Keypad Enter. (#5606) | 2023-12-18 18:23:53 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 0d582dabf3 | Fixed warning (amend 54c1bde) | 2023-12-14 17:24:23 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 6cfe3ddf52 | InputTextMultiline: Tabbing through a multi-line text editor using ImGuiInputTextFlags_AllowTabInput doesn't activate it. (#3092, #5759, #787) | 2023-12-14 17:15:43 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 54c1bdeceb | Internals: removed unused ImGuiItemStatusFlags_FocusedByTabbing. (#4449) Amend 1a7526d | 2023-12-14 16:45:40 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 4afffa36e9 | InputTextMultiline: Fixed Tab character input not repeating (1.89.4 regression) | 2023-12-14 16:31:18 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| f6836ff37f | Misc: Rework debug display of texture id in Metrics window (amend) (#7090) Amend 96b5b17 | 2023-12-12 18:24:30 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 07dbd46ddd | Misc: Rework debug display of texture id in Metrics window to avoid compile-error when ImTextureID is defined to be larger than 64-bits. (#7090) | 2023-12-12 18:18:52 +01:00 |  | 
			
				
					| 
							
							
								 Nahor | 34646627aa | ColorEdit4: improve components width computation to better distribute the error (#7120) (#7123) | 2023-12-12 11:07:01 +01:00 |  | 
			
				
					| 
							
							
								 Nahor | 86512eac06 | DragScalarN, SliderScalarN, InputScalarN, PushMultiItemsWidths: improve multi-components width computation to better distribute the error. (#7120, #7121) | 2023-12-12 00:34:18 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 03298fe875 | Windows: Fixed some auto-resizing path using style.WindowMinSize.x (instead of x/y).  (#7106) | 2023-12-10 12:53:20 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 69f524ba95 | DragScalarN, SliderScalarN, InputScalarN, PushMultiItemsWidths: Added when component <= 0. (#7095) | 2023-12-08 18:43:29 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 9d8de45313 | Image(): comment and minor refactor to resurface the fact that a border size may be added. (#2118) Make more similar to ImageButton() | 2023-12-07 16:07:50 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 5366bd09bf | Scrolling: internal scrolling value is rounded instead of truncated. (#6677) | 2023-12-07 15:47:18 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| c58d2c89c3 | Tabs: Added ImGuiTabItemFlags_NoAssumedClosure to enable app to react on closure attempt. (#7084) | 2023-12-07 14:20:35 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 1fade35159 | DragScalarN, SliderScalarN, InputScalarN, PushMultiItemsWidths: Fixed incorrect pushes into ItemWidth stack when number of components is 1. [#7095] | 2023-12-07 14:01:53 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 58ca5f6424 | Shortcut(): clearer early out in SetShortcutRouting() -> CalcRoutingScore() path. | 2023-12-06 16:15:11 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| d72e1563d4 | Removed CalcListClipping() marked obsolete in 1.86. (#3841) + comments Amend 64daeddf | 2023-12-06 15:10:12 +01:00 |  | 
			
				
					| 
							
							
								 Anılcan Gülkaya | 9a2985611c | Backend: Android: Remove Redundant Check (#7093) | 2023-12-06 04:29:40 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 0b77980cab | Moved Tables API related declarations to their own section in imgui.h | 2023-12-05 18:13:04 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| aaf157cfdd | Commented out ImGuiFreeType::BuildFontAtlas() obsoleted in 1.81. Commented out legacy ImGuiColumnsFlags_XXX symbols redirecting to ImGuiOldColumnsFlags_XXX, obsoleted in 1.80. Amend 9499afdfand72de6f336 | 2023-12-05 17:04:19 +01:00 |  | 
			
				
					| 
							
							
								 Johel Ernesto Guerrero Peña | 1fd5ff7152 | Avoid C++26 removed deprecated arithmetic conversion on enumerations. (#7088, #7089. #2983, #3040) | 2023-12-05 12:13:08 +01:00 |  | 
			
				
					| 
							
							
								 Bryce Berger | 52886872f1 | Misc: Added IMGUI_USER_H_FILENAME to change the path included when using IMGUI_INCLUDE_IMGUI_USER_H. (#7039) | 2023-12-01 14:26:21 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 5768de79e2 | InputText, ColorEdit, ColorPicker: better support for undocumented ImGuiItemFlags_ReadOnly flag. (#7079, #211) Amend fdc526e8f | 2023-12-01 13:57:28 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| b112d73edb | Menus: amend to clarify/fix static analyzer warning.  (#6671, #6926) | 2023-11-29 17:08:06 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 2ee40d3cf9 | Menus: Tweaked hover slack logic, adding a timer to avoid situations where a slow vertical movements toward another parent BeginMenu() can keep the wrong child menu open. (#6671, #6926) | 2023-11-29 16:46:21 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| b4b864e40a | Backends: Vulkan: Fixed mismatching allocator passed to vkCreateCommandPool() vs vkDestroyCommandPool(). (#7075) | 2023-11-29 14:24:25 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| d2b0167610 | Fixed link error when using IMGUI_DISABLE_DEBUG_TOOLS | 2023-11-29 14:09:39 +01:00 |  | 
			
				
					| 
							
							
								 ocornut | 7965494ff3 | Debug Tools: Added DebugFlashStyleColor() to identify a style color. Added to Style Editor. | 2023-11-28 19:40:38 +01:00 |  |